'Tis The Season - Buyers Want A Place To Call Home For The Holidays! - 09/21/08 07:31 PM
Now is the time of the year when buyers are focused on a home purchase that will have them settled in for the holidays! But, many buyers don't realize that it could take 8-10 weeks for their mortgage to be processed. This weekend might very well be the cut-off date for a Thanksgiving closing. And, most people dread winter moves.

Town Of LaGrange, NY - Open Space Initiative Put On Ballot - 09/08/08 06:45 PM

LaGrange voters will be asked to approve up to $2 million to preserve open space on November 4th. The town adopted an open space plan last year that includes acquiring conservation easements on farmland and other parcels in LaGrange to protect them against development. The town based its open space plan, in part, on surveys of LaGrange residents.
The LaGrange town board last week voted 4-1 to place the open space initiative on the ballot.
